3 Development in the Netherlands 12 IPE’s established in 1996 situated in and performed by public libraries division and specialisation of subjects related to the public library network coordination by NPLA, Netherlands public library association Public library network  1115 public libraries  1800 mobile stops  4,3 mln members  140 mln loans

4 Europe Direct in The Netherlands Network of 13 service points Europe Direct Based on 12 former Info points in public libraries and 4 Carrefours Agreements for 4 years and annual contracts as of 1st of April 2005 General website, Al@din service, Europe dossiers Professional group related to the Association for common promotion, representation, library campaigns

7 The Netherlands Information Relays of the European Union - Europe Points connected to Public Library Network Visitors in public libraries having a Service Point 8.621.000 National information campaign through 1115 public libraries Europa-binder with leaflets in all libraries National library campaigns on Euro, elections Enlargement, etc.

8 Network national co-ordination – Coordinated Working Group – Europe Direct Meeting twice a year Annual Working Plan, –Division of Tasks, co-operation –National information distribution system Special projects Discussion-list: Info-Europa-L national training information markets outreach activities

9 Promotion of the Network 1-3 articles a year in Public Library Journal Announcements through digital newsletter Europe dossiers at national library portal-NPLA Connected to regional websites Local/Regional library contacts Regional contacts with EDC’s National contacts with ‘European’ organisations

16 Library portal Bibliotheek.nl and digital reference service Al@din Information desk on the internet Answering questions Knowledge data base Domain specialization: Europe Solving queries together Promotion in co- operation

17 Reference service for students and learners about Europe Cooperation in regional reference teams Al@din: personal reference at www.bibliotheek.nlwww.bibliotheek.nl 3329 visits; 903 queries a day Increase in queries from children and young people 48% for school, studies 39% for personal interest
